brown truck came today

From john bange on 9/25/2012 3:55:42 PM

I'm working on a new long neck.  I bought a Vega Woodsongs long neck.  I have loved my Little Wonder long neck custom and have always wanted another for back up.  Inquires to Deering as to price and wait time have not been what I wanted to hear.

I have not been a fan of the gold finish on the rim, armrest and t/p of the Woodsongs so I bought all the stuff to change it to nickel.

My plan was to change out the black head also but having seen it up close with the Deering supplied nickel tension rim, I might use it for a while.  I hear the black heads are very bright sounding so I'll have to see.

I am waiting on a Kerschner tail piece, a 5 star arm rest ,a 5th string post and new Rotomatics

When all this stuff arrives, I will string with 30, 40, 50, 60lb fishing line and a nylgut 4th string from Aquilla's all nylgut set...good fun

I can break a string every once in a while so the back up with pre-stretched strings is nice to have

sounds cool John - tell us more about Nylon strings!

john bange says:
9/29/2012 9:15:19 AM

I use fishing line because most of the sets are too short. The Labella 17 set is long enough but too light. I can use 30lb for my 1st, 50lb for 2nd, 60 for 3rd and 40 for my 5th. I use a nylgut 4th string fron the Aquilla all nylgut set...it lasts forever...I was wearing out the wound 4th's. My banjo's are quite loud set up like this. Stretching in takes no longer than real banjo strings.

john bange says:
10/4/2012 10:01:41 AM

the modifications to both banjos are as follows:
grover tuners
shubb 5th string long capo
5th string post(nut)
Kerschner tailpiece
Snuffy Smith 3/4 bridge
all 5 nylon strings
Rickard closed end nuts
new tension brackets from Elderly
5 star nickel arm rest
this has given me 2 nearly identical long neck banjos...one with a maple neck and one with mahogany. all gold pieces are gone from the Woodsongs and replaced with nickel. I got the nickel tension hoop from Deering and sold the gold stuff on ebay or BHO classified. I am keeping the shiny black head for now. I cannot hear any sound differences between the two. I used my handy dandy drum head tension guage to get the head tension as close as possible. The fishing line and the Aquilla nylon 4th string are stretched in now and both banjos will stay in tune for a few tunes...as long as the nylon strings on my Martin which is as good as it gets with any nylon string instrument I have had...I still tune a lot...always have.
